Rosary of the Week

I purchased this rosary when I was in Medjugorje. It is made from the stones around the  Bosnian village. The crucifix has the name of the village as well as Mary's words "Mir. Mir. Mir." (Peace. Peace. Peace.)For the photo I hung the rosary on a picture I purchased at a Mejugorje conference at Notre Dame last May. It is a photo of the statue made of Mary to the descriptions of the six visionaries. Her eyes seem to  follow as you move around the room. The beads really  grab tactile attention as I pray because they are rough and very oddly shaped. It is a wonderful way to nudge my memories of  my time there. These rocks are visible all over the area. I spent a week there in 2007 after a visit to the Holy Land with a Peace group.This June it will be 30 years since the first apparition.I am attending another Medjugorje conference at Notre Dame in a few weeks.
